SUMMARY
The Data Center Systems and Design Program Manager (DC-SDPM) is a professional who specializes in designing and implementing security systems and measures for our client’s global datacenter and managing the program. To accomplish this, they engage in the day-to-day project efforts, is responsible for the key project teams and dependency partners to deliver the security solution.
The DC-SDPM must be capable of working on their own initiative to provide risk-based services for the deployment of datacenter security solutions and connected devices for our client. Building and maintaining strong relationships with clients, ensuring their satisfaction and trust.
Clients’ needs are rapidly changing in this dynamic work environment, and it is essential the DC-SDPM maintains a flexible, logical, open minded, and adaptive approach. By combining your skills, creativity and customer focus you will support and ensure competitive technical solutions are deployed in line with our global standards and in the process deliver a world class service.
